Had my first ride at night today, 75 odd miles from the south coast back home to Sudbury. A few observations:

  • It’s great fun riding at night, especially on unlit roads. Less traffic, less distractions, more focus on riding.
  • The normal lights on a Honda S-Wing are useless night, on an unlit road you have to use the long beam
  • Fog is somehow much more real on a bike! It’s very there and very in your face, kinda scary at first
  • The A32 going up the Meon Valley is an awesome road to ride, great place to practise turning at speed
